Types of Childcare Options
There are several forms of childcare solutions, each catering to different age groups and schedules. A few of the most common types of child care choices include:
- Daycare facilities: Daycare centers are facilities offering take care of children of numerous centuries, usually from infancy to preschool. These facilities are licensed and regulated by the condition, making certain they meet specific requirements for security, cleanliness, and staff qualifications. Daycare centers offer structured tasks, meals, and guidance for children in friends setting.
- Family Child Care Homes: Family childcare homes tend to be tiny, home-based childcare services run by just one caregiver or a little group of caregivers. These providers provide a far more tailored and family-like environment for children, with a lot fewer kiddies in care compared to daycare centers. Family childcare houses may offer versatile hours and prices, making all of them a well known choice for moms and dads who need much more individualized look after their child.
- Preschools: Preschools tend to be academic organizations that offer very early childhood training for the kids usually between the many years of 2 to 5 years old. These programs concentrate on preparing kids for kindergarten by launching them to fundamental educational concepts, social skills, and psychological development. Preschools often work on a school-year routine and supply part-time or full time alternatives for moms and dads.
- Pre and post class products: Before and after college programs are made to provide care for school-aged young ones during hours before and after the normal college time. These programs offer multiple activities, research assistance, and direction for kids while parents are in work. Before and after school programs are usually provided by schools, neighborhood facilities, or exclusive businesses.
- Nanny or Au set: Nannies and au pairs are people who supply in-home child care solutions for households. Nannies are often experienced professionals who offer full-time care for young ones in the family's residence, while au sets tend to be young adults from foreign nations whom reside because of the household and provide social exchange along side childcare. Nannies and au pairs provide personalized care and freedom in scheduling for parents.
Things to consider When Selecting Childcare
When choosing child care towards you, it is vital to think about several elements to make sure that you see an excellent and suitable selection for your child. A few of the important aspects to consider consist of:
- Licensing and Accreditation: it is vital to select an authorized and approved child care provider, since this helps to ensure that the facility fulfills certain standards for protection, sanitation, staff skills, and system quality. Licensing and accreditation indicate that supplier features withstood a rigorous evaluation process and it is dedicated to maintaining large criteria of treatment.
- Staff Qualifications and Training: The skills and education for the staff within childcare facility are very important in supplying high quality look after kiddies. Seek providers with trained and skilled caregivers, in addition to staff who are certified in CPR and first-aid. Staff-to-child ratios may important, as they determine the level of attention and direction that all son or daughter gets.
- Curriculum and Program strategies: think about the curriculum and program activities offered by the little one care provider, because they perform a substantial part into the development and understanding of the youngster. Look for programs that provide age-appropriate tasks, academic opportunities, and possibilities for socialization. A well-rounded curriculum which includes play, art, music, and outdoor time can donate to your son or daughter's overall development.
- Health and Safety Policies: make sure the little one treatment provider has actually strict safety and health policies set up to safeguard the wellbeing of one's kid. Try to find services that follow proper hygiene practices, have protected entry and exit treatments, and keep maintaining on a clean and child-friendly environment. Inquire about disaster treatments, illness guidelines, and just how the provider manages accidents or situations.
- Parent Involvement and correspondence: Select a kid care supplier that promotes moms and dad participation and maintains open communication with people. Choose providers that offer possibilities for moms and dads to participate in activities, activities, and meetings, in addition to regular revisions on your own child's progress and well-being. A solid partnership between parents and caregivers can result in a confident and supporting child care knowledge.
Finding Childcare In Your Area
Now you have actually considered the factors to take into consideration in a child care provider, it is the right time to start the search for quality child care towards you. Here are some tips and sources to help you find a very good option for your youngster:

- Request Recommendations: begin by asking for tips from family, friends, neighbors, and coworkers who've kids in child care. Private referrals are a valuable way to obtain information about high quality childcare providers locally. Ask about their particular experiences, what they like in regards to the provider, and any issues they might have.
- Analysis Online: utilize online learning resources such as for example childcare directories, parenting websites, and social media groups to analyze child care providers locally. Try to find providers with positive reviews, high rankings, and detailed information on their programs and solutions. Numerous providers have actually websites or social media marketing pages where you are able to find out more about their facilities and staff.
- See childcare Centers: Schedule visits to potential childcare centers to visit the facilities, meet the staff, and observe the system for action. Pay attention to the sanitation, safety precautions, and total atmosphere regarding the center. Inquire about the curriculum, staff skills, everyday routines, and policies for a feeling of the way the center runs.
- Interview Caregivers: When ending up in potential caregivers, enquire about their particular experience, instruction, and way of child care. Inquire about their viewpoint on control, interaction with parents, and how they manage emergencies or challenging habits. Trust your instincts and select caregivers that hot, conscious, and tuned in to your kid's requirements.
- Examine recommendations: Request recommendations from the childcare provider and contact them to inquire about their experiences because of the provider. Inquire about the quality of care, interaction with moms and dads, staff communications, and any concerns they could have had. References can provide valuable ideas into the provider's reputation and track record.
- Give consideration to price and ease: look at the cost of child care and just how it fits into your spending plan, plus the convenience of the positioning and hours of procedure. Compare prices, fees, and repayment options among various providers for the best worth for your family. Think about elements particularly transportation, proximity to your home or work, and versatility in scheduling.
